Prostatic hypertrophy can be improved through lifestyle adjustments, drug treatment, surgical treatment, etc. Prostatic hypertrophy may be related to factors such as abnormal hormone levels and inflammatory stimulation.
1. Lifestyle adjustment
Patients with prostatic hyperplasia need to avoid sitting for long periods of time, reduce cycling time, and reduce pressure on the perineum. Pay attention to controlling the amount of water you drink and limiting fluid intake before going to bed can help reduce the frequency of nocturia. You can take a warm sitz bath every day, with the water temperature maintained at about 40 degrees Celsius, for 15 minutes a day to relieve discomfort. It is necessary to limit the intake of alcohol and spicy food in the diet, and appropriately supplement zinc-rich foods such as pumpkin seeds.
2. Alpha blockers
Tamsulosin hydrochloride sustained-release capsules can relax prostate smooth muscle and improve symptoms of dysuria. Doxazosin mesylate tablets are suitable for patients with moderate to severe lower urinary tract symptoms, and may cause adverse reactions such as orthostatic hypotension. This type of drug reduces bladder outlet obstruction by blocking α1 adrenergic receptors. Blood pressure changes need to be monitored regularly during medication.
3. 5α reductase inhibitor
Finasteride tablets can inhibit the conversion of testosterone into dihydrotestosterone, and long-term use can reduce the size of the prostate. Dutasteride soft capsules are suitable for patients with significantly enlarged prostate size and require continuous use for several months to be effective. Such drugs may cause sexual dysfunction, and prostate-specific antigen indicators should be reviewed every six months during medication.
4. Plant preparations
Puxitai tablets contain pollen extract, which can improve urinary abnormalities and perineal swelling and pain. Saw palmetto fruit extract capsules have anti-inflammatory effects and are suitable for patients with mild prostatic hyperplasia. Some plant preparations may affect coagulation function and should be used with caution in perioperative patients.
5. Surgical treatment
Transurethral resection of the prostate removes hyperplastic tissue through an electrical resection ring, and a urinary catheter needs to be left in place for 3 days after surgery. Holmium laser enucleation of the prostate requires less bleeding and is suitable for patients taking anticoagulant drugs. Surgery is suitable for cases of recurrent urinary retention or bladder stones. Complications such as retrograde ejaculation may occur after surgery.
Patients with prostatic hypertrophy should maintain regular bowel movements to avoid increased abdominal pressure and perform moderate aerobic exercise such as brisk walking or swimming three times a week. Pay attention to supplementing your diet with lycopene and vitamin D, and limit caffeine intake. Acute urinary retention requires immediate catheterization and regular urological follow-up to monitor changes in residual urine volume and urinary flow rate. People with hypertension or diabetes need to control their underlying diseases at the same time. Some cardiovascular drugs may aggravate urinary symptoms and need to be adjusted in time.
